Le secteur du mobile gaming explose en 2024. Les joueurs attendent des dépôts instantanés, une sécurité sans compromis et une expérience qui ne les oblige pas à quitter l’application pour saisir leurs coordonnées bancaires. Cette exigence de friction quasi‑nulle a poussé les opérateurs de casino en ligne à adopter les solutions de paiement intégrées aux smartphones, notamment Apple Pay et Google Pay.
Sur le même front, les programmes de fidélité deviennent le levier principal pour transformer un simple dépôt en une relation durable. En combinant des paiements ultra‑rapides avec des récompenses ciblées, les casinos augmentent le lifetime value (LTV) et réduisent le churn. Vous pouvez approfondir ces bonnes pratiques sur le site de référence https://www.esav.fr/ qui recense des ressources utiles pour les développeurs et les marketeurs du secteur.
Ce guide se décline en six parties :
1. Pourquoi les paiements mobiles sont indispensables.
2. Intégration technique d’Apple Pay.
3. Implémentation pas à pas de Google Pay.
4. Architecture hybride pour les deux solutions.
5. Programme de fidélité tirant parti des dépôts instantanés.
6. Optimisation UX, notifications et suivi des performances.
À la fin de votre lecture, vous disposerez d’un plan d’action complet : le code à insérer, les tests à réaliser et la stratégie loyalty à déployer pour obtenir des résultats mesurables.
1. Pourquoi les paiements mobiles sont indispensables aux casinos en ligne
Entre 2022 et 2024, plus de 68 % des joueurs de jeux de casino sur mobile déclarent préférer les solutions de paiement intégrées aux systèmes d’exploitation. Cette évolution s’explique par trois facteurs majeurs.
Premièrement, la rapidité : un paiement Apple Pay ou Google Pay se finalise en moins de deux secondes, contre 7 à 12 secondes pour une saisie manuelle de carte. Cette différence réduit le taux d’abandon du tunnel de dépôt de 22 % en moyenne. Deuxièmement, la sécurité. Les deux services utilisent la tokenisation, ce qui élimine le stockage de données sensibles sur les serveurs du casino. Troisièmement, la conformité. Les plateformes sont déjà certifiées PCI‑DSS, ce qui simplifie les audits internes.
Ces atouts se traduisent directement en une hausse du lifetime value. Un joueur qui peut déposer en un clin d’œil est plus enclin à augmenter ses mises, à explorer de nouvelles machines à sous et à rester fidèle à la marque.
Sécurité et conformité (PCI‑DSS, tokenisation)
Apple Pay et Google Pay créent un jeton unique pour chaque transaction. Ce jeton ne peut être réutilisé, ce qui empêche le vol de données et répond aux exigences PCI‑DSS sans que le casino ne gère les numéros de carte. En outre, les deux services offrent des mécanismes de vérification biométrique (Face ID, Touch ID, empreinte digitale) qui ajoutent une couche d’authentification supplémentaire.
Études de cas : opérateurs qui ont vu leurs revenus grimper de +15 %
- CasinoX a intégré Apple Pay en Q1 2023. Le taux de conversion des dépôts est passé de 41 % à 58 %, générant une hausse de revenu moyen par utilisateur (ARPU) de 17 %.
- Spin&Win a déployé Google Pay sur Android en Q3 2023, réduisant le churn de 9 % grâce à des notifications push déclenchées dès le paiement confirmé.
Ces chiffres montrent que la simple addition d’un bouton de paiement mobile peut créer un effet boule de neige sur les indicateurs clés.
2. Les bases techniques pour intégrer Apple Pay dans une application de casino
L’intégration d’Apple Pay repose sur trois prérequis : un compte Apple Developer actif, un Merchant ID dédié et un certificat de paiement (Apple Pay Payment Processing Certificate).
- Création du Merchant ID dans le portail Apple Developer → Identifiers → Merchant IDs.
- Génération du certificat : téléchargez le CSR depuis votre serveur, importez‑le dans le portail, puis téléchargez le certificat signé.
- Configuration du serveur : le serveur doit pouvoir communiquer avec le PSP (Payment Service Provider) via HTTPS et gérer les requêtes de validation de paiement.
Étapes de configuration du SDK (iOS 15+)
- Ajoutez le framework
PassKità votre projet Xcode. - Dans le
Info.plist, activez la capacité Apple Pay et associez le Merchant ID. - Créez une instance
PKPaymentRequest: définissez le pays, la devise (EUR), les réseaux de cartes acceptés et le montant du dépôt. - Insérez le bouton
PKPaymentButtondans votre vue de dépôt, en respectant les dimensions recommandées (44 × 44 px minimum).
Gestion du flux de paiement
- L’utilisateur touche le bouton Apple Pay.
- Le SDK génère une payment session et renvoie un payment token crypté.
- Le token est transmis à votre serveur via une requête POST sécurisée.
- Le serveur déchiffre le token, l’envoie au PSP, reçoit la confirmation et renvoie le statut à l’application.
Astuces de debug et sandbox
- Activez le mode Sandbox dans les réglages du compte test Apple Pay.
- Utilisez les logs de Xcode (
os_log) pour suivre les étapes de création de session. - Simulez des réponses d’erreur (ex. : carte refusée) pour vérifier la gestion des rejets côté UI.
3. Google Pay : mise en œuvre pas à pas pour Android
Google Pay requiert l’inscription au Google Pay API et la création d’un projet Google Cloud contenant les clés d’API.
- Créer le projet dans Google Cloud Console, activer l’API Google Pay et récupérer le
merchantId. - Ajouter la dépendance
com.google.android.gms:play-services-walletdans lebuild.gradle. - Déclarer les permissions
INTERNETetACCESS_NETWORK_STATEdans leAndroidManifest.xml.
Implémentation du PaymentsClient
val paymentsClient = Wallet.getPaymentsClient(
context,
Wallet.WalletOptions.Builder()
.setEnvironment(WalletConstants.ENVIRONMENT_TEST)
.build()
)
Construction du PaymentDataRequest
val request = PaymentDataRequest.fromJson(
"""
{
"apiVersion":2,
"apiVersionMinor":0,
"allowedPaymentMethods":[{
"type":"CARD",
"parameters":{
"allowedAuthMethods":["PAN_ONLY","CRYPTOGRAM_3DS"],
"allowedCardNetworks":["VISA","MASTERCARD"]
},
"tokenizationSpecification":{
"type":"PAYMENT_GATEWAY",
"parameters":{"gateway":"example","gatewayMerchantId":"exampleGatewayId"}
}
}],
"transactionInfo":{
"totalPriceStatus":"FINAL",
"totalPrice":"25.00",
"currencyCode":"EUR"
},
"merchantInfo":{"merchantName":"CasinoMobile"}
}
""".trimIndent()
)
Le bouton GooglePayButton s’affiche automatiquement si le device supporte le service.
Traitement du token et communication avec le PSP
- Récupérez le
PaymentDatadansonActivityResult. - Extrayez le champ
paymentMethodData.tokenizationData.token. - Transmettez ce token à votre serveur via HTTPS.
- Le serveur le valide auprès du PSP, renvoie le statut et, en cas de succès, déclenche la mise à jour du solde du joueur.
Vérifications de conformité
- Respectez la Google Play Policy : aucune collecte de données personnelles sans consentement.
- Implémentez le GDPR : anonymisez les identifiants de transaction dès la réception du token.
4. Fusionner les deux solutions : architecture hybride et meilleures pratiques
Choisir entre une base de code unique (Flutter, React Native) ou deux projets natifs dépend de la taille de votre équipe et du délai de mise sur le marché.
| Critère | Flutter / React Native | Native iOS & Android |
|---|---|---|
| Temps de développement | 30 % plus rapide pour UI commune | Meilleure performance native, accès complet aux SDK |
| Maintenance | Un seul code base, mise à jour simultanée | Deux bases séparées, besoin de synchroniser les évolutions |
| Accès aux fonctionnalités | Plugins tiers (apple_pay, google_pay) | SDK officiels, contrôle total des callbacks |
| Coût initial | Moins cher pour MVP | Plus cher, mais plus robuste à long terme |
Gestion des différences de flux
- Apple Pay : le bouton doit être placé à droite du champ de montant, couleur blanche sur fond noir.
- Google Pay : le bouton s’adapte automatiquement au thème du système, il est recommandé de le placer au même niveau que le bouton « Déposer ».
Stratégie de fallback
Intégrez un module de paiement par carte classique (Stripe, Adyen) qui s’affiche uniquement si le portefeuille numérique n’est pas disponible. Cette redondance garantit un taux de conversion supérieur à 95 % même sur les appareils plus anciens.
5. Concevoir un programme de fidélité qui tire parti des paiements instantanés
Un bon programme de loyalty repose sur trois piliers : la simplicité, la personnalisation et la réactivité.
- Points : chaque euro déposé via Apple Pay ou Google Pay rapporte 2 points bonus, alors que le même dépôt via carte classique ne rapporte que 1 point.
- Niveaux : Bronze (0‑999 pts), Argent (1 000‑4 999 pts), Or (5 000+ pts). Chaque palier débloque des tours gratuits, des cashbacks ou des invitations à des tournois privés.
- Récompenses dynamiques : utilisez les données de transaction en temps réel pour proposer des offres limitées (ex. : « Déposez 50 € aujourd’hui et recevez un multiplicateur de points x3 pendant 24 h »).
Intégrer les dépôts Apple Pay/Google Pay comme déclencheurs de points bonus
Chaque paiement réussi déclenche immédiatement une requête vers le service loyalty. Le serveur calcule le nombre de points, les ajoute au profil du joueur et renvoie une notification push confirmant le gain. Cette boucle en moins de deux secondes crée une sensation de gratification instantanée, très prisée dans les jeux de casino où le RTP et la volatilité sont déjà des facteurs d’adrénaline.
Utiliser les données de transaction en temps réel pour des offres dynamiques
Analysez le montant, la fréquence et le canal de paiement. Si un joueur utilise Google Pay pour trois dépôts consécutifs supérieurs à 30 €, proposez‑lui un pari gratuit sur le prochain spin de la machine à sous « Volcano Rush ». Cette approche augmente le wagering tout en renforçant la perception d’un service sur‑mesure.
Exemple de tableau de progression
| Dépôt cumulé | Points bonus | Récompense | Impact sur churn estimé |
|---|---|---|---|
| > 10 € | +20 pts | 5 tours gratuits | -2 % |
| > 50 € | +120 pts | 20 % de cashback | -5 % |
| > 100 € | +300 pts | Invitation à un tournoi VIP | -8 % |
Ces chiffres, basés sur des tests A/B internes, montrent que chaque palier supplémentaire réduit le churn de façon proportionnelle.
6. Optimiser l’expérience utilisateur : UI/UX, notifications et suivi des performances
Placement des boutons Apple Pay / Google Pay
- Positionnez les boutons au-dessus du champ de code promo, afin qu’ils soient visibles dès le premier regard.
- Utilisez la taille minimale recommandée (44 × 44 px) et ajoutez un petit texte « Déposer instantanément » pour clarifier la fonction.
- Sur les écrans de petite taille, regroupez les deux boutons dans un carrousel horizontal pour éviter le débordement.
Design de la page de fidélité
- Tableau de bord à deux colonnes : à gauche, le solde de points et le niveau actuel ; à droite, les offres du jour et l’historique des gains.
- Couleurs contrastées (or pour le niveau Or, argent pour Argent) afin d’attirer l’œil sur les récompenses les plus précieuses.
- Incluez un bouton « Réclamer maintenant » qui ouvre directement le module de dépôt avec le montant pré‑rempli correspondant à l’offre.
Automatiser les notifications push et email
- Après paiement : push « Vous avez reçu 40 pts bonus ! Consultez votre tableau de bord. »
- Avant expiration d’une offre : email « Votre multiplicateur x3 expire dans 2 h, déposez maintenant ! »
- Milestone atteint : notification « Félicitations, vous êtes maintenant Niveau Or ! Profitez de 100 € de cash‑back. »
Ces messages doivent être envoyés via un service de messaging fiable (Firebase Cloud Messaging, Amazon SNS) et respectent le consentement GDPR.
KPIs à surveiller
- Taux de conversion dépôt : nombre de dépôts / nombre de visites de la page de dépôt.
- Valeur moyenne du dépôt (VMD) : somme des dépôts / nombre de dépôts.
- ARPU post‑bonus : revenu moyen par utilisateur après l’attribution de points.
- Rétention 7 jours : pourcentage de joueurs actifs une semaine après un paiement instantané.
En suivant ces indicateurs, vous pourrez ajuster le montant des bonus, la fréquence des notifications et la présentation UI pour maximiser le ROI.
Conclusion
Nous avons parcouru le chemin complet, de la justification business des paiements mobiles à la mise en œuvre technique d’Apple Pay et Google Pay, en passant par une architecture hybride, un programme de fidélité pensé autour des dépôts instantanés, et enfin l’optimisation de l’expérience utilisateur.
Les bénéfices attendus sont tangibles : réduction du taux d’abandon du tunnel de paiement, augmentation du ARPU de 12‑18 % et diminution du churn de près de 10 % grâce à des offres ciblées. La clé du succès réside dans la rapidité du paiement, la transparence du système de points et la capacité à mesurer chaque interaction.
Il ne vous reste plus qu’à activer le sandbox d’Apple Pay, lancer un pilote Google Pay sur un segment de joueurs, configurer le moteur de loyalty et suivre les premiers KPI. Une fois les premiers résultats validés, étendez la solution à l’ensemble de votre catalogue de jeux de casino, y compris les slots à haute volatilité et les tables de blackjack à RTP élevé.
Pour aller plus loin, consultez les forums développeurs d’Apple et de Google, ainsi que la documentation officielle de chaque SDK. Le site de référence https://www.esav.fr/ propose également des liens utiles vers des guides de conformité PCI‑DSS et des études de cas anonymisées.
Passez à l’action : testez, mesurez, itérez, et transformez chaque dépôt instantané en une opportunité de fidélisation durable.
